Subject: [PATCH 2/5] ARM: sun6i: dt: Add GMAC clock node to the A31 DTSI
Date: Thu,  6 Mar 2014 00:27:12 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1394036835-22007-3-git-send-email-wens@csie.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1394036835-22007-1-git-send-email-wens@csie.org>

The GMAC uses 1 of 2 sources for its transmit clock, depending on the
PHY interface mode. Add both sources as dummy clocks, and as parents
to the GMAC clock node.

 arch/arm/boot/dts/sun6i-a31.dtsi | 28 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 1 file changed, 28 insertions(+)

di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un6i-a31.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un6i-a31.dtsi
index 4d2a2bf..ee09e4c 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un6i-a31.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un6i-a31.dtsi
@@ -229,6 +229,34 @@
 			clocks = <&osc24M>, <&pll6>;
 			clock-output-names = "spi3";
 		};
+
+		/*
+		 * The following two are dummy clocks, placeholders used in the gmac_tx
+		 * clock. The gmac driver will choose one parent depending on the PHY
+		 * interface mode, using clk_set_rate auto-reparenting.
+		 * The actual TX clock rate is not controlled by the gmac_tx clock.
+		 */
+		mii_phy_tx_clk: clk at 1 {
+			#clock-cells = <0>;
+			compatible = "fixed-clock";
+			clock-frequency = <25000000>;
+			clock-output-names = "mii_phy_tx";
+		};
+
+		gmac_int_tx_clk: clk at 2 {
+			#clock-cells = <0>;
+			compatible = "fixed-clock";
+			clock-frequency = <125000000>;
+			clock-output-names = "gmac_int_tx";
+		};
+
+		gmac_tx_clk: clk at 01c200d0 {
+			#clock-cells = <0>;
+			compatible = "allwinner,sun7i-a20-gmac-clk";
+			reg = <0x01c200d0 0x4>;
+			clocks = <&mii_phy_tx_clk>, <&gmac_int_tx_clk>;
+			clock-output-names = "gmac_tx";
+		};
 	};
